/Linux-v5.10/drivers/tee/ |
D | tee_shm_pool.c | 111 const size_t page_mask = PAGE_SIZE - 1; in tee_shm_pool_mgr_alloc_res_mem() local 116 if (vaddr & page_mask || paddr & page_mask || size & page_mask) in tee_shm_pool_mgr_alloc_res_mem()
|
/Linux-v5.10/drivers/ata/ |
D | sata_sx4.c | 988 u8 page_mask; in pdc20621_get_from_dimm() local 996 page_mask = 0x00; in pdc20621_get_from_dimm() 1002 writel(((idx) << page_mask), mmio + PDC_DIMM_WINDOW_CTLR); in pdc20621_get_from_dimm() 1016 writel(((idx) << page_mask), mmio + PDC_DIMM_WINDOW_CTLR); in pdc20621_get_from_dimm() 1027 writel(((idx) << page_mask), mmio + PDC_DIMM_WINDOW_CTLR); in pdc20621_get_from_dimm() 1040 u8 page_mask; in pdc20621_put_to_dimm() local 1048 page_mask = 0x00; in pdc20621_put_to_dimm() 1052 writel(((idx) << page_mask), mmio + PDC_DIMM_WINDOW_CTLR); in pdc20621_put_to_dimm() 1065 writel(((idx) << page_mask), mmio + PDC_DIMM_WINDOW_CTLR); in pdc20621_put_to_dimm() 1076 writel(((idx) << page_mask), mmio + PDC_DIMM_WINDOW_CTLR); in pdc20621_put_to_dimm()
|
/Linux-v5.10/drivers/gpu/drm/i915/gem/selftests/ |
D | huge_pages.c | 62 unsigned int page_mask = obj->mm.page_mask; in get_huge_pages() local 88 unsigned int bit = ilog2(page_mask); in get_huge_pages() 111 } while ((rem - ((page_size-1) & page_mask)) >= page_size); in get_huge_pages() 113 page_mask &= (page_size-1); in get_huge_pages() 114 } while (page_mask); in get_huge_pages() 119 GEM_BUG_ON(sg_page_sizes != obj->mm.page_mask); in get_huge_pages() 152 unsigned int page_mask) in huge_pages_object() argument 158 GEM_BUG_ON(!IS_ALIGNED(size, BIT(__ffs(page_mask)))); in huge_pages_object() 179 obj->mm.page_mask = page_mask; in huge_pages_object()
|
/Linux-v5.10/include/linux/qed/ |
D | qed_chain.h | 575 u32 cur_prod, page_mask, page_cnt, page_diff; in qed_chain_set_prod() local 581 page_mask = ~p_chain->elem_per_page_mask; in qed_chain_set_prod() 590 page_diff = (((cur_prod - 1) & page_mask) - in qed_chain_set_prod() 591 ((prod_idx - 1) & page_mask)) / in qed_chain_set_prod()
|
/Linux-v5.10/drivers/infiniband/hw/mlx5/ |
D | mem.c | 178 u64 page_mask; in mlx5_ib_get_buf_offset() local 184 page_mask = page_size - 1; in mlx5_ib_get_buf_offset() 185 buf_off = addr & page_mask; in mlx5_ib_get_buf_offset()
|
D | mr.c | 1030 const int page_mask = page_align - 1; in mlx5_ib_update_xlt() local 1045 if (idx & page_mask) { in mlx5_ib_update_xlt() 1046 npages += idx & page_mask; in mlx5_ib_update_xlt() 1047 idx &= ~page_mask; in mlx5_ib_update_xlt() 2276 u64 page_mask = ~((u64)ibmr->page_size - 1); in mlx5_ib_map_mtt_mr_sg_pi() local 2289 pi_mr->pi_iova = (iova & page_mask) + in mlx5_ib_map_mtt_mr_sg_pi() 2291 (pi_mr->ibmr.iova & ~page_mask); in mlx5_ib_map_mtt_mr_sg_pi()
|
/Linux-v5.10/include/linux/ |
D | agp_backend.h | 55 unsigned long page_mask; member
|
D | edac.h | 412 unsigned long page_mask; /* used for interleaving - member
|
/Linux-v5.10/net/rds/ |
D | ib_recv.c | 276 gfp_t slab_mask, gfp_t page_mask) in rds_ib_refill_one_frag() argument 294 RDS_FRAG_SIZE, page_mask); in rds_ib_refill_one_frag() 314 gfp_t page_mask = gfp; in rds_ib_recv_refill_one() local 318 page_mask = GFP_HIGHUSER; in rds_ib_recv_refill_one() 337 recv->r_frag = rds_ib_refill_one_frag(ic, slab_mask, page_mask); in rds_ib_recv_refill_one()
|
/Linux-v5.10/drivers/gpu/drm/ |
D | drm_agpsupport.c | 428 head->page_mask = head->agp_info.page_mask; in drm_agp_init()
|
/Linux-v5.10/drivers/firmware/ |
D | stratix10-svc.c | 617 size_t page_mask = PAGE_SIZE - 1; in svc_create_memory_pool() local 634 if ((vaddr & page_mask) || (paddr & page_mask) || in svc_create_memory_pool() 635 (size & page_mask)) { in svc_create_memory_pool()
|
/Linux-v5.10/drivers/gpu/drm/i915/gem/ |
D | i915_gem_object_types.h | 249 I915_SELFTEST_DECLARE(unsigned int page_mask);
|
/Linux-v5.10/include/drm/ |
D | drm_agpsupport.h | 26 unsigned long page_mask; member
|
/Linux-v5.10/mm/ |
D | mlock.c | 457 unsigned int page_mask = 0; in munlock_vma_pages_range() local 484 page_mask = munlock_vma_page(page); in munlock_vma_pages_range() 508 page_increm = 1 + page_mask; in munlock_vma_pages_range()
|
D | gup.c | 28 unsigned int page_mask; member 661 ctx->page_mask = HPAGE_PMD_NR - 1; in follow_pmd_mask() 758 ctx->page_mask = 0; in follow_page_mask() 1059 ctx.page_mask = 0; in __get_user_pages() 1126 ctx.page_mask = 0; in __get_user_pages() 1131 ctx.page_mask = 0; in __get_user_pages() 1133 page_increm = 1 + (~(start >> PAGE_SHIFT) & ctx.page_mask); in __get_user_pages()
|
/Linux-v5.10/drivers/edac/ |
D | edac_mc.c | 117 edac_dbg(4, " csrow->page_mask = 0x%lx\n", csrow->page_mask); in edac_mc_dump_csrow() 843 csrow->page_mask); in edac_mc_find_csrow_by_page() 847 ((page & csrow->page_mask) == in edac_mc_find_csrow_by_page() 848 (csrow->first_page & csrow->page_mask))) { in edac_mc_find_csrow_by_page()
|
D | amd76x_edac.c | 212 csrow->page_mask = mba_mask >> PAGE_SHIFT; in amd76x_init_csrows()
|
D | pasemi_edac.c | 170 csrow->page_mask = 0; in pasemi_edac_init_csrows()
|
/Linux-v5.10/include/linux/mtd/ |
D | onenand.h | 98 unsigned int page_mask; member
|
/Linux-v5.10/drivers/misc/habanalabs/common/ |
D | mmu_v1.c | 245 u64 page_mask = (ctx->hdev->asic_prop.mmu_hop_table_size - 1); in get_phys_addr() local 246 u64 shadow_hop_addr = shadow_addr & ~page_mask; in get_phys_addr() 247 u64 pte_offset = shadow_addr & page_mask; in get_phys_addr()
|
D | memory.c | 640 u64 page_mask, total_npages; in init_phys_pg_pack_from_userptr() local 678 page_mask = ~(((u64) page_size) - 1); in init_phys_pg_pack_from_userptr() 699 dma_addr &= page_mask; in init_phys_pg_pack_from_userptr()
|
/Linux-v5.10/drivers/infiniband/sw/rxe/ |
D | rxe_mr.c | 159 mem->page_mask = PAGE_SIZE - 1; in rxe_mem_init_user() 243 *offset_out = offset & mem->page_mask; in lookup_iova()
|
D | rxe_verbs.h | 309 int page_mask; member
|
/Linux-v5.10/drivers/gpu/drm/i915/display/ |
D | intel_display_power.c | 5237 u32 page_mask; member 5243 { .num_channels = 1, .type = INTEL_DRAM_DDR4, .page_mask = 0xF }, 5244 { .num_channels = 2, .type = INTEL_DRAM_LPDDR4, .page_mask = 0x1C }, 5245 { .num_channels = 2, .type = INTEL_DRAM_DDR4, .page_mask = 0x1F }, 5246 { .num_channels = 4, .type = INTEL_DRAM_LPDDR4, .page_mask = 0x38 }, 5251 { .num_channels = 1, .type = INTEL_DRAM_LPDDR4, .page_mask = 0x1 }, 5252 { .num_channels = 1, .type = INTEL_DRAM_DDR4, .page_mask = 0x1 }, 5253 { .num_channels = 2, .type = INTEL_DRAM_LPDDR4, .page_mask = 0x3 }, 5254 { .num_channels = 2, .type = INTEL_DRAM_DDR4, .page_mask = 0x3 }, 5272 for (config = 0; table[config].page_mask != 0; config++) in tgl_bw_buddy_init() [all …]
|
/Linux-v5.10/drivers/media/i2c/ |
D | adv7604.c | 135 unsigned long page_mask; member 615 if (page >= ADV76XX_PAGE_MAX || !(BIT(page) & state->info->page_mask)) in adv76xx_read_reg() 630 if (page >= ADV76XX_PAGE_MAX || !(BIT(page) & state->info->page_mask)) in adv76xx_write_reg() 3013 .page_mask = BIT(ADV76XX_PAGE_IO) | BIT(ADV7604_PAGE_AVLINK) | 3060 .page_mask = BIT(ADV76XX_PAGE_IO) | BIT(ADV76XX_PAGE_CEC) | 3104 .page_mask = BIT(ADV76XX_PAGE_IO) | BIT(ADV76XX_PAGE_CEC) | 3529 if (!(BIT(i) & state->info->page_mask)) in adv76xx_probe()
|